The National AIDS Program (NAP) is the organization mandated by the Government to direct the National Response to HIV/AIDS in the Turks and Caicos Islands. It is the central governmental agency responsible for ensuring a comprehensive and integrated HIV/AIDS/STI prevention and control program in the Turks and Caicos Islands.
Created through Executive Order, The National AIDS Program was mandated to "advise the Minister of Health regarding policy and program development for the prevention and control of AIDS." The group serves as the main coordinating body and is responsible for designing, implementing, monitoring and evaluating the National HIV/AIDS response. In addition, the National AIDS Program, serves as a venue for intensive policy discussion between government and NGOs to ensure that policies formulated and actions taken truly respond to Human Immunodefiency Virus (HIV) and AIDS as a social development issue requiring multi-sectoral attention.
The vision for the National AIDS Program is to create a fully empowered nation where different individuals and sectors work together to prevent HIV transmission and lessen its impact on affected persons and the community in general. The group strives to provide comprehensive services and support to reduce the spread of HIV in TCI and is guided by the following strategic initiatives:
- Advocacy, policy development and legislation
- Care and support for people living with HIV and AIDS
- Prevention, especially for young people and vulnerable groups
- Coordination, program design and implementation
